Teen bike rider hit in store’s parking lot

 A 15-year-old bicyclist was taken to a Quad-City hospital Sunday afternoon after he collided with a Ford Escape.

The accident happened shortly before 6 p.m. in the parking lot of the Hy-Vee store at 1823 E. Kimberly Road, Davenport.

The female driver of the Ford talked to police while an ambulance transported the boy.

“He was coming through the parking lot, and they collided,” said Staci Nicholson, of LeClaire, Iowa.  “He was talking coherently. He gave his mom’s name and phone number.”

The boy’s name and condition were unavailable late Sunday.
